You are right mam.Sudden onset of cough without any cold symptoms,which is continuous in this age group can be due to some foreign body inhalation into the respiratory tract.
Although baby of this age are predominantly breast fed but due to their mouthing habit which develops at this age there are chances of foreign body inhalation.A clear history is also difficult to get in this age.
Baby may remain active and feed normally if the object is not in main bronchus.Sometimes it is really very difficult for the parents to assess and thus the child should get evaluated by a pediatrician in the presence of this symptom and if there is suspicion.
On clinical examination there may be decreased air entry on one side of chest and on X ray there can be hyperinflation or collapse.

Yeah,it can be due to other causes.But in this scenario possibility of foreign body should be ruled out.
It can be detected clinically or by Xray.Sometimes CT chest or direct bronchoscope examination may be needed depending on the situation.
Once detected in most of the cases it can be removed through bronchoscope(an instrument like endoscope with camera) under general anesthesia.Very rarely surgery may be needed.
